Transaction afa7b4ca7960b33623249281dc5928bd2cc2b4662837a255986ea1ba562f21a5
1 Input
1 Output
-
afa7b4ca7960b33623249281dc5928bd2cc2b4662837a255986ea1ba562f21a5:0
- value
- 18807
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8ba31f7054ccd4af36481ad13e0871f655e85e1
- address
- bc1qazarrac9fnx54umysxk38cy8raj4ap0pzf0vpj